On Sat, Aug 15, 2015 at 12:23:50PM -0400, Nico Kadel-Garcia wrote: > > "mock" has a similar problem. That one is simply foolish: The > /usr/bin/mock command *isn't* mock. It's a helper program to summon > the /usr/sbin/mock, which is the "real" mock. Hilarity ensues if you > have PATH set up as many admins do with "/sbin" first, or if you > compile a local copy and have /usr/local/sbin before /usr/local/bin. > > The list goes on. authconfig, liveinst, gparted, setup, tuned-adm, etc. etc. Most of them are victims of ”consolehelper”.
